User Approval

User approval extension for Caffeine AI.

Overview

This skill adds approval-based user management. Users request access; admins approve or reject. Approved users gain access to protected features.

Backend

Approval-based user management:

Prerequisite: You must follow extension-authorization first, as this integration depends on it.

There is a prefabricated module mo:caffeineai-user-approval/approval that cannot be modified. It provides approval-based user management with role-based access control.

On initState, existing admins are automatically approved. All other users are pending.

IMPORTANT: Apply the right authorization and/or approval check to each public function.

Frontend

Approval-based user management:

User Approval Flow

  • Check approval status (isCallerApproved)
  • If not approved, show option to request approval (requestApproval)
  • Block access to main features for non-approved users
  • Admins have access to all features of the application
  • Display approval status clearly in the UI

Admin Dashboard

For admin users, provide a dashboard to:

  • List all users with their approval status (listApprovals)
  • Approve or reject users (setApproval)
  • View and assign user roles (using getCallerUserRole and assignCallerUserRole)
